Kitchen Tile Remodeling in Frederick, MD

Kitchen tile remodeling services encompass a range of updates and enhancements to improve the appearance and functionality of a kitchen’s tiled surfaces. This includes replacing outdated or damaged tiles, installing new designs, or upgrading existing tile work to match a desired aesthetic. Projects often involve redoing backsplashes, flooring, or accent walls, providing homeowners with options to refresh the look of their kitchen or address issues such as cracks, stains, or wear over time. Project Types

Common Kitchen Tile Remodeling Jobs

Kitchen tile replacement - updating outdated or damaged tiles for a fresh, modern look.

Backsplash installation - adding decorative and protective tile accents behind sinks and stoves.

Tile repair services - fixing cracked or loose tiles to maintain a safe and attractive surface.

Custom tile design - creating unique patterns and layouts to enhance kitchen style.

Grout cleaning and sealing - improving tile appearance and preventing moisture damage.

Floor tile remodeling - replacing worn or stained flooring for a durable, stylish kitchen surface.

Kitchen Tile Remodeling Questions

What types of tile are suitable for kitchen remodeling? Ceramic, porcelain, and natural stone tiles are popular choices for durability and style in kitchen spaces.

Can tile be installed over existing surfaces? Yes, existing surfaces like old tiles or damaged countertops can often be covered, provided they are properly prepared.

How should kitchen tiles be maintained after installation? Regular cleaning with mild detergents and prompt attention to spills help keep tiles looking their best.

What are common design options for kitchen tile layouts? Herringbone, subway, and mosaic patterns are common choices to enhance kitchen aesthetics.
